A weighted moving average is a forecasting method that assigns different weights to past observations, allowing more recent data to have a greater influence on the average than older data. This technique enhances the accuracy of forecasts by adapting to trends or changes in data patterns over time. By incorporating various weights, it provides a more nuanced view of past performance, which is crucial for making informed decisions in sales forecasting and trend analysis.
